推荐答案
在 MariaDB 中,可以使用 mysql
命令来恢复数据库。以下是恢复数据库的基本步骤:
使用
mysql
命令恢复数据库:mysql -u username -p database_name < backup_file.sql
username
:数据库用户名。database_name
:要恢复的数据库名称。backup_file.sql
:包含数据库备份的 SQL 文件。
恢复整个数据库服务器:
mysql -u username -p < full_backup.sql
full_backup.sql
:包含整个数据库服务器备份的 SQL 文件。
本题详细解读
1. 使用 mysql
命令恢复数据库
mysql
命令不仅可以用于执行 SQL 查询,还可以用于恢复数据库。通过将备份文件重定向到 mysql
命令,可以将备份文件中的 SQL 语句逐条执行,从而恢复数据库。
- 参数说明:
-u username
:指定数据库用户名。-p
:提示输入密码。database_name
:指定要恢复的数据库名称。< backup_file.sql
:将备份文件的内容重定向到mysql
命令。
2. 恢复整个数据库服务器
如果你有一个包含整个数据库服务器备份的 SQL 文件(例如通过 mysqldump
命令生成的备份文件),你可以使用 mysql
命令来恢复整个数据库服务器。
- 参数说明:
-u username
:指定数据库用户名。-p
:提示输入密码。< full_backup.sql
:将整个数据库服务器的备份文件内容重定向到mysql
命令。
3. 注意事项
- 权限:确保你使用的数据库用户具有足够的权限来恢复数据库。
- 备份文件:确保备份文件是完整的,并且没有损坏。
- 数据库状态:在恢复数据库之前,确保数据库处于可用状态,并且没有其他用户正在使用数据库。
通过以上步骤,你可以使用 mysql
命令轻松恢复 MariaDB 数据库。